The architecture of the Juliana Hospital in Terneuzen

Merkelbach uses the metaphor of language to make it clear that people cannot simply assume they understand the language of a building. Architect J.P. Kloos shows in this building that he is a man of plain language. He has understood the task well and the love and care that goes with nursing care speaks from the architecture.Another article in this issue also pays attention to this hospital. An extensive photo report is printed herewith.Illustrations: photos, plgr., tek.
